Abstract

The present invention relates to a frequency modulation type gas exhausting and flow stabilizing device which belongs to a gas flow silencer or a gas exhausting device of an ordinary machine or an engine. The device is composed of an outer pipe, an inner pipe, a contraction-expansion pipe, a frequency modulation conduit and a transmission component, wherein the frequency modulation conduit is used for modulating the length difference of a central passage and a spiral passage and the size of changing interference frequency for achieving the optimal interference effect; the frequency modulation conduit is connected with the contraction-expansion pipe for use to enhance a flow stabilizing effect. The frequency modulation type gas exhausting and flow stabilizing device is used for the engine and especially for volume type compressor equipment.

Description

FREQUENCY MODULATING EXHAUST SILENCER
The present invention relates to a kind of air exhaust muffler device with frequency modulation, it belongs to the silencer for gas flow or the venting gas appliance of general machine or motor.
A kind of having of causing for periodic fluctuation pressure of the common generation of the blast air of gas compressor, motor, particularly positive-displacement compressor transferred noise and the mixed noise of another kind for the turbulence noise of stream swirl generation.Wherein turbulence noise is the broadband random noise, and frequency spectrum is the broadband continuous spectrum, and its amplitude is less, and exhaust airstream pulse and noise are not played a major role.And the accent noise is wherein arranged, and on frequency spectrum, except that fundamental frequency, also have some to become the higher harmonics composition of integral multiple with fundamental frequency, being called has the accent noise.Its energy is bigger, concentrates on again on the limited frequency peak, and amplitude is very big usually, and they have determined the total amplitude of exhaust sound dynamic characteristic, and its frequency spectrum shows as one group of bar-shaped discrete line spectrum.The exhaust sound of positive-displacement compressor is normally planted the stack of noise like this, is that the accent noise is arranged owing to what play a decisive role in the exhaust sound, so reduce the fundamental component of transferring in the noise is arranged, and just becomes the major technique approach of such machine exhausting silencer.
Muffler shown in European patent EP-A-0184060 and Japan Patent spy drive the spirality baffler shown in the clear 57-191409, all adopt the interior pipe and the outer tube of coaxial line configuration, connect with helical baffle therebetween and the formation spirality channel, intersection interferes in the downstream to make in this passage in the air-flow and interior pipe air-flow, reaches the purpose of noise elimination.But its interference frequencies all is uncontrollable.Because the wave length of sound that changes such as delivery temperature, pressure, working medium constant cause changes and the change of the gas frequency that the operating conditions variation causes, it is accurately consistent that the required interference frequencies of Design Theory and practical application is difficult to, can not frequency modulation just often make on-the-spot interfere lost efficacy or interference effect relatively poor, can't guarantee the requirement of interfering fully.
For solving the above problems, the invention provides a kind of interference frequencies of regulating continuously at the scene and interfere to reach fully, effectively reduce the air exhaust muffler device that the fluctuation pressure of transferring noise is arranged.
Structure of the present invention comprises the interior pipe of coaxial line configuration and the outer tube of its two ends band adpting flange, be provided with helical baffle between outer tube and the interior pipe, this dividing plate and outer tube wall and outer wall of inner tube constitute spirality channel, have perforation on the tube wall of interior pipe outlet section, the convergent-divergent pipe that its inlet flushes with this device import is equipped with in interior pipe entrance point upstream, in the pipe phasitron is arranged in the invention is characterized in, this phasitron is connected with the transmission part that is arranged on interior pipe outlet end downstream by drive link, and can move along the tube wall of interior pipe, the flow area of spirality channel and central passage is equal substantially.
Air-flow enters this device behind convergent-divergent pipe current stabilization, just be divided into two-way, one the tunnel through central passage, and its approach is shorter, and another road is through spirality channel, its approach is longer, when meet in the outlet port, if when the length of central passage and spirality channel differs 1/2 wavelength that equals certain frequency sound wave, the pulsed sound of this frequency then, at two passage confluce phase shifts, 180 degree, the anti-phase interference of two homenergic ripples is offset.Phasitron moves in interior pipe, and the high and low position difference of the perforation in hiding on the pipe outlet section has just changed the length difference of central passage and spirality channel, thereby changed interference frequencies, reaches the purpose of adjustable interference frequencies.
The present invention is a FREQUENCY MODULATING EXHAUST SILENCER, and it has following advantage compared with the prior art:
Compact structure, simple can reduce because of interfering significantly to the fluctuation pressure of accent or noise are arranged, and it is effective to eliminate the noise.Its interference frequencies is adjustable continuously arbitrarily, can satisfy the scene requirement that caused interference frequencies changes because of operating conditions changes, and can guarantee to interfere fully.Frequency adjustment range is wide, the machinery of the applicable different main frequencies of device of a specification.

The structure of FREQUENCY MODULATING EXHAUST SILENCER: interior pipe 4, outer tube 5, convergent-divergent pipe 6, helical baffle 7, be connected with welding or other mechanical fasteners method.A phasitron 3 is arranged in interior pipe 4, and it is connected with nut with usefulness mechanical supports such as handle 14, operating handles 1 with umbrella gear 13,15 by screw mandrel 12.Its inlet of pipe 4 entrance point upstreams flushed with this device import in convergent-divergent pipe 6 was contained in.Air-flow is discharged from gas compressor, and convergent-divergent pipe 6 convergent-divergents by on the FREQUENCY MODULATING EXHAUST SILENCER obtain current stabilization thus.Interior pipe 4 is straight pipe, and its intracavity space is the passage of pulse pneumatic, i.e. central passage.On the tube wall of interior pipe 4 outlet sections, have some apertures 2, for having the noise of accent to begin interference position, frequency modulation uses.In the long section of the perforation of pipe 4 on outlet section tube wall BC(promptly by the B point to the C point, B point is positioned at the upper end first of managing on 4 perforated sections and arranges on the horizontal line of aperture 2.The C point is positioned on the pipe 4 outlet end end face horizontal lines), its length is decided by the requirement of tuning range.The length of phasitron 3 must be greater than the length of BC.The A point is positioned on the pipe 4 entrance point end face horizontal lines, and it is airflow diversion becomes synchronous acoustic pressure wave or pressure wave with spirality channel to central passage a basic point.Helical baffle 7 forms spirality channel between pipe 4 outer walls and outer tube 5 inwalls in being fixed on, the cross-sectional flow area of spirality channel and central passage cross-sectional flow area about equally, with the air-flow that causes two strands of energy to equate substantially.Phasitron 3 is straight pipe, on its two ends end face, respectively adorns a upper bracket 9 and lower support frame 11, and a circular hole 8 is arranged on the upper bracket 9, and a screw 10 is arranged on the lower support frame 11.Screw 10 and screw mandrel 12 engagements.Circular hole 8 is made the usefulness of screw mandrel 12 positioning and guidings.The passive umbrella gear 13 that is contained on screw mandrel 12 ends is meshed with driving bevel gear 15 on being contained in operating handle 1.The tube wall that operating handle 1 passes outer tube 5 links to each other with handle 14.When shaking handle 14, then screw mandrel 12 rotates, and phasitron 3 is moved up and down in interior pipe 4, manages the height of 4 apertures, 2 positions in phasitron 3 hides, and has determined the interference position of sound wave in central passage and the spirality channel.When the difference of two passage lengths that are in this position equals to interfere the odd-multiple of 1/2 wavelength of sound wave and 1/2 wavelength, then its corresponding frequency, the interference frequencies that will regulate exactly.
Exhaust airstream enters this device after convergent-divergent pipe current stabilization, enter two passages that passage section equates substantially at A point shunting two-way, one the tunnel through central passage, its approach is shorter, another road is through spirality channel, its approach is longer, and two strands of air-flows are in the punch position B point junction interference of the unsheltered upper end of interior pipe.The selection of this point can be regulated by operating handle according to the air-flow frequency of sound wave of required interference, the accent pulsation sound wave that has of this frequency just caused the ripple of same frequency, homenergic, antiphase when air-flow arrived the B point two passwaies, it is interfered mutually and offset, determining of B point position, promptly interference frequencies can be provided by following formula:
In f=C/ λ n=2n-1/2 * C/ △ L formula: the f-interference frequencies
C-is by the local velocity of sound of gas
λ n-has the voicing wave-wave long
△ L-central passage and the spirality channel propagation path length difference when the B point
n=1,2,3,……
Shake handle 14, operating handle 1 rotation through driving bevel gear 15 and driven bevel pinion 13, drives screw mandrel 12 rotations, thereby phasitron 3 is moved up and down along the inner tubal wall of interior pipe 4 outlet sections, to reach the purpose of regulating interference frequencies.
Be configured in a 25800m 3The test result of the FREQUENCY MODULATING EXHAUST SILENCER on the large-scale screw rod gas compressor of/h is listed below: this compressor delivery pressure is 3.8kg/cm 2, exhaust has transfers the noise 20~25dB that can decay after interfering, and the frequency adjustable scope is 150~250Hz, device size: latus rectum is φ 400mm, long 1240mm, and size is less, noise reduction is very remarkable, and frequency-tuning range is bigger simultaneously, can satisfy the engineering application need.
The present invention also can be used for the usefulness that low frequency has other mechanical air-flow voltage stabilizing of transferring the fluctuation pressure exhaust, as reciprocating air compressor etc.
